As the UK accelerates its efforts to meet its 2050 climate change targets, Waste-to-Energy (WtE) technologies have emerged as a potential solution for addressing both waste management challenges and renewable energy demands. The UK’s 2050 climate change target, set under the legally binding Climate Change Act (2008) and reinforced by the Net Zero Strategy (2021), aims to reduce greenhouse gas emissions to net zero by 2050. This requires significant reductions in carbon emissions across all sectors, including waste management, energy production, and industrial processes. While WtE processes have been widely studied in global sustainability contexts, their specific role in supporting the UK’s net-zero ambitions remains underexplored. This research critically examines the feasibility of WtE technologies in contributing to the UK’s climate change mitigation strategy. It evaluates the environmental, economic, and policy dimensions of WtE implementation, assessing both the opportunities and limitations within the framework of UK environmental regulations. The study survey gathered structured responses from key stakeholders in waste management, energy production, and policymaking to explore the social, technical, and regulatory challenges of WtE adoption. While advancements in plant operations have enhanced technical efficiency and emission controls, public apprehensions persist regarding air quality, health risks, and environmental impact. Economic and regulatory barriers further complicate large-scale integration, necessitating stronger policy support, technological innovation, and community engagement. 53% of the respondent believes that WtE contributes to the broader discourse by positioning WtE as a key component of the UK’s decarbonization strategy. The findings provide actionable insights for policymakers, industry leaders, and researchers, advocating for evidence-based decision-making to optimize WtE's role in achieving a sustainable and resilient future for the UK and beyond.
